Of course, right as I post this I get an idea...

Turns out, I have quite a lot of cables/rats nest, including the powerplay cable. There is XLR cable carying 48V, there is my samsung wireless charger,... By untangling the powerplay cable from all this and moving the samsung charger my mouse is now back to charging solid as a rock. It's already up 10%, and although the reported charge in Ghub is still wildly inconsistent, the upward trend is obvious (good enough for me I guess). Charging is now 100% reproducable removing it and replacing it, turning off and on.. all good. I like to think I know a lil bit about computers and electricity, it seems to me that the powerplay cable is insufficiently shielded. Bit of a letdown for a (let's face it) rather expensive ecosystem. Literally the only device/cable I've ever had this issue with.

Leaving this up in case it might help someone else out debugging, and as a hint to the logitech product development team to maybe spent the extra couple cents on a shielded cable (which is otherwise pretty nice imo, braided and everything)
